Parliament Adjourned Amid Protests Over NEET Exam Irregularities

India's Rajya Sabha was adjourned multiple times due to opposition protests concerning the NEET exam irregularities and alleged police action against demonstrators. Opposition MPs demanded a statement from Union Home Minister Amit Shah regarding the police action. The government, through its allies, criticized the opposition for using students for political gain and expressed confidence in Prime Minister Modi's commitment to reforms. The Lok Sabha, however, passed the Public Examination Amendment Bill 2026 amid heated debate.
